The Hidden Cost of Traditional Snow Pusher Skid Shoes
Picture this: It’s the middle of winter. Temperatures have dropped below freezing. Your best operator has been pushing snow hard with their snow pusher pressed against the asphalt. When the storm ends, you see uneven wear patterns on your snow pusher skid shoes. Sound familiar?
Traditional maintenance gives you two expensive choices. You can call a mobile welding unit to come to your job site. Or you can take your equipment out of service and fix it in your shop. Both options mean significant downtime. You lose productivity. Your clients wait for clear parking lots.
This maintenance challenge affects everyone. Whether you run Metal Pless Liveboxx snow pusher, Western Pile Driver snow pusher, Fisher Storm Boxx snow pusher, or Blizzard Power Pusher snow pusher equipment, the problem is the same. Standard one-piece skid shoes wear unevenly. You have to replace entire shoes when only part of them is worn out. This creates waste and unnecessary expense.

The Science Behind Superior Performance
The MōDUS® system is the industry’s only patented modular snow pusher skid shoe solution available. Each part is built from cast steel that wears like an excavator bucket tooth. This gives you exceptional toughness in harsh winter conditions.
What makes this system special is our exclusive Winter® Carbide technology. This is a special carbide weld that gives you the wear resistance of tungsten carbide. But it adds superior impact resistance too. In simple terms, it’s as tough as tungsten carbide but won’t shatter when it hits obstacles.
Traditional tungsten carbide can break apart when it strikes curbs or debris. Winter® Carbide stays strong while giving you extended wear life. Each cast steel wear pad has four molded pockets filled with over 15 cubic inches of this advanced material. The result? Snow pusher wear shoes that last five times longer than standard factory options.

Operational Advantages for Snow Removal Contractors
Quick Field Rotation and Replacement
The modular design lets you quickly rotate wear pads from front to back and side to side. This addresses the common problem of uneven wear caused by different operator experience levels.
The goal is to maintain even pressure across the blade. But inexperienced operators often have trouble telling how level their snow pusher is with the surface they’re clearing. This leads to unintentional “nose down” or “heel down” pressure. The MōDUS® system handles these real-world operating conditions through simple field adjustments.
A complete rotation takes just 30 minutes using standard tools. You don’t need cutting, torching, or welding. Fleet Management Benefits
This extensive compatibility means fleet managers can standardize their snow pusher wear shoe maintenance approach across different equipment types. While the MōDUS® system requires different adapter plate shapes and sizes for various plow models, all systems use the same cast steel modular wear shoes. This dramatically simplifies technician training and parts ordering for the actual wear parts.
Surface Adaptability
The system performs best on concrete and asphalt surfaces at medium operating speeds. If you work on sensitive surfaces like ornamental pavers or decorative concrete, the modular design allows quick switching to polyurethane wear pads. You don’t need to replace the entire system.
